Method

Each rung is the newest figure for this NDC from one federal price system, shown with its own unit. Part D is matched by drug name because CMS publishes no NDCs there; it is gross spending, before confidential rebates.

Medicare Part D

No Medicare Part D plan in CMS's quarterly files lists this product. That usually means it is discontinued, a repackager's listing, or a product no plan has added to its formulary.
